Sintering 2011 conference call for papers extended
January 26, 2011
Organisers of the International Conference on Sintering 2011 have announced an extension to the abstract submission date. Authors are now requested to submit abstracts by 15 February 2011 via the event website.
Jointly organised by the Korean Powder Metallurgy Institute and the Korean Ceramic Society the conference will be held at the Shilla Jeju Hotel, Jeju Island, Korea, from 28 August to 1 September 2011.
Sintering 2011 will address the latest advances in sintering science and technology of powder-based materials. Topics range from sintering fundamentals to industrial applications and all classes of materials will be covered. The topics will include.
- Fundamental aspects of sintering
- Modeling of sintering at multiple scales
- Sintering of multi-material and multi-layered systems
-
Microstructural evolution in sintering processes
- Novel Sintering Processes (field-assisted, microwave, etc)
- Sintering of nano-structured materials
- Sintering of electronic materials
- Sintering in emerging energy and bio applications
- In-situ measurements and analyses of sintering
- Other sintering-related topics
